After many, many miles on my ST1100s I too have settled for 7.5 on both bikes. Outfit and solo.I also changed the oil out to 7.5 weight oil. Mixed 10 and 5 weight. I'm 185 lbs.
5 on one side and 15 on the other would be the same as 10 on each side wouldn’t it? On my 1300, 5 on both sides is too soft and 10 on both sides is too harsh, so I put 5 in one and 10 in the other, and that works just right for me. Should I remove the damper rod bolt to back the top bolt out?A STandard 1100 has drain screws. The left fork can be drained/filled with the dipstick method. The right fork is very awkward to dis/re-assemble on your own to be able to properly measure the levels with a dipstick. I refill the right fork with 90% of the correct volume - with a large syringe.
